Output 79d605953826267185b9a562b2d95cb49e1ec3812d58ffa65a95e3ba7954b940:39

value
8037652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 004f5ea62c8ec663745f932526cd7b0db05c2b22 OP_EQUAL
address
M7voK8oAWyzr9gJ6nhYtibuDBEyBsP4kfT
transaction
79d605953826267185b9a562b2d95cb49e1ec3812d58ffa65a95e3ba7954b940
spent
true